The Aztec empire fell because the Mexica weren't exactly awesome neighbors and the arrival of Cortes served as a catalyst for the Tlaxcaltecs and the Mexica's tributaries to break free. Not that the subsequent Spanish rule was an improvement, but without the indigenous struggle against Aztec rule, Cortes and his little gang would've been slaughtered, guns or not.
